Bradford Street Commercial Development
Large-Format Retail and Commercial Facility

Project Overview
Essen Engineering provided structural engineering services for the Bradford Street commercial development in Paraparaumu, delivering a modern retail and commercial facility incorporating approximately 1,760m² of retail, office and storage accommodation.
The building was designed to accommodate retail, office, storage and staff facilities within a flexible structure capable of supporting future tenant requirements and long-term commercial use.
The project required a practical structural solution capable of delivering:
-
Large open retail floor areas
-
Mezzanine office accommodation
-
Efficient construction methodology
-
Seismic and wind resilience
-
Long-term flexibility for future tenants
Coordination with architectural, civil and fire engineering disciplines was essential to achieve an efficient and commercially viable outcome.
The Engineering Solution
The structure combines:
-
Reinforced concrete foundations
-
Precast concrete wall panels
-
Structural steel portal frames
-
Steel-framed mezzanine floors
-
Composite suspended floor systems
-
Roof bracing and seismic load-resisting systems
This approach provided large clear-span retail areas while maintaining strength, durability and construction efficiency.

Te Tupe Industrial Park
Commercial & Industrial Business Park
Essen Engineering provided structural engineering design and construction support for the Te Tupe Industrial Park development at Nikau Junction, Paraparaumu.
The development transformed vacant land into a modern commercial and industrial business park comprising multiple tenancy units with integrated office accommodation. Designed using precast concrete construction and structural steel framing, the development provides durable and flexible accommodation for a range of commercial occupiers.
The Engineering Solution
The structural system combines:
Precast concrete wall panels
Structural steel framing
Mezzanine office floors
Wind and seismic design
Durable commercial construction systems
